Bella Morte Bleed The Grey Sky Black [CD] By: Hydro |
Pouring out like fog from an inside the club we find Bella Morte back with a new release for those sorely unabashed ears. This being their 8th release called “Bleed The Grey Sky Black “we find the same old Bella Morte. Firstly I feel they could have pulled something a bit more creative with this title. They have fallen into the land of uber stereotypical goth. Luckily the music isn’t quite as humdrum.
The first thing I notice here is that Andy Deane doesn’t croon quite as much as he did on prior releases. Then again the last album of theirs I bought was the Death rock EP so I’m a few records behind. But none the less I’m trudging into this musical journey open minded and ready for the kill. Alas, most of the music presented is very mediocre to my auditory senses. I was expecting much more out of BM. There are some diamonds in the rough though. Their cover of “Earth Angel” is just perfect. Andy’s vocals are just amazing in this track. I’d say if they were going for the electro death rock feel they nearly nailed it with about half this album. As my friend Regan said about this album “Fruit at the bottom, waiting to be stirred!” and she was oh so right. You see the couple of stand out rocker tracks are near the end of the record. “As the Storm Unfolds” and “Bleed Again” are two of the better songs that Bella Morte has to offer to the music gods this time round. As a whole though I found this album a one listen deal. |
